Take-a-book-leave-a-book stands are going up at four Leamington parks.
The Little Libraries are being put up and supervised by the Rotary Club.
Mayor John Paterson says it's supposed to encourage residents to read more, and maybe get them interested in libraries again. "It's hard to say what's going to happen. It's a sharing kind of thing, it's free, so who knows. It should have some positive effect."
The Little Libraries will look like big wooden mail boxes or bird houses, and are expected to be filled with books for all ages.
